THE EL ARROYO SIGN STOLE MY CLEVER INTRO!Join us for this week's episode of Unlocking Moves with Clay McPhail - the restauranteur behind Austin's iconic El Arroyo Tex-Mex restaurant and its legendary roadside sign! Known for its witty, satirical, and sometimes controversial messages, the El Arroyo sign has captured the hearts and occasionally provoked the tempers of Austinites for decades. But there’s much more to Clay’s story than clever jokes and Tex-Mex!Unlocking Moves dives into the pivotal moments in a leader's journey that unlocked their true potential! Most of us only like to talk about our "glory" stories - but host Kurt Wilkin is a firm believer that we learn more from our stumbles and mistakes, our "gory" stories. In this week’s episode, Clay reveals the accidental origins of the witty (and sometimes controversial) El Arroyo sign, and how the sign became both an amazing marketing superpower AND the bane of his existence (because he and his team had to come up with clever new messages EVERY…SINGLE…DAY for over 25 years! Clay also shares his origin story - from working his way through college at Texas to creating the legendary and controversial sign and the Tex Mex brand you know and love - with many lessons learned along the way. Clay reflects on the courage required to leap into entrepreneurship and missed opportunities, and he shares the raw and unexpected power that mentorship can have on those around us. Take the Quiz HereAbout Clay McPhail - Clay has over 35 years of experience in the restaurant industry. He’s the former owner, founder & CEO of El Arroyo restaurant and creator of it’s famous sign, and now the owner of 5280 Burger Bar. Clay is a legend and continues to impact lives through food, laughter, and genuine connections. About Kurt Wilkin - Kurt is a connector - of dots, ideas, and people. For over 30 years, he has advised high-growth companies, starting his career with Ernst & Young, and today in his roles as chairman of HireBetter and managing partner of Bee Cave Capital. He's a serial entrepreneur with multiple successful exits and has helped hundreds of entrepreneurs and CEOs build their companies.
